Residential carpet repair services involve restoring carpets that have experienced damage or wear over time. These services typically include fixing tears, burns, or holes, as well as patching areas where the carpet has become stained or heavily worn. Skilled service providers use specialized techniques to seamlessly blend repairs with existing flooring, helping to extend the life of the carpet and improve its appearance. This process can often be completed without the need for full replacement, making it a practical solution for homeowners looking to maintain their flooring without significant expense.

Carpet repair services are especially useful for addressing common problems such as unraveling edges, loose seams, or carpet dents caused by furniture. They can also repair damage from pet accidents, spills, or accidental injuries that leave visible marks or holes. These repairs not only improve the aesthetic appeal of a space but also help prevent further damage that could lead to more costly replacements. Homeowners often turn to local contractors for these services when they want to preserve their existing flooring while resolving specific issues quickly and effectively.

This type of service is frequently sought for various types of residential properties, including single-family homes, apartments, and condominiums. It is suitable for carpets in living rooms, bedrooms, hallways, and stairs-anywhere that damage or wear has occurred. Whether a property has wall-to-wall carpeting or area rugs, professional repair services can address localized issues or larger sections needing attention. This flexibility makes carpet repair a convenient option for homeowners who want to keep their spaces looking fresh and well-maintained.

The overview below groups typical Residential Carpet Repair projects into broad ranges so you can see how smaller, mid-sized, and larger jobs often compare in your area.

In many markets, a large share of routine jobs stays in the lower and middle ranges, while only a smaller percentage of projects moves into the highest bands when the work is more complex or site conditions are harder than average.

Smaller Repairs - typical costs for minor carpet patching or small tear repairs usually range from $250 to $600. Many routine jobs fall within this middle band, depending on the size and location of the damage.

Moderate Repairs - larger patching, seam fixing, or stain removal projects generally cost between $600 and $1,200. These projects are common and often involve more extensive work but remain within a predictable range.

Extensive Restoration - significant repairs such as re-stretching or replacing large sections can range from $1,200 to $3,000. Fewer projects reach this level, typically involving more complex or larger-area jobs.

Full Carpet Replacement - replacing an entire carpet can cost between $2,000 and $5,000 or more, depending on the size and quality of materials chosen. Larger, more detailed installations tend to push costs into the higher end of this spectrum.

Actual totals will depend on details like access to the work area, the scope of the project, and the materials selected, so use these as general starting points rather than exact figures.

Can residential carpet repair fix stains and discoloration? Yes, many local contractors offer services to address stains, discoloration, and other surface damages to restore the appearance of carpets.

Is carpet repair suitable for pet damage? Repair services can often address pet-related issues such as tears, holes, or worn areas caused by pets, helping to improve the carpet's condition.

What types of carpet damage can be repaired? Common repairs include fixing burns, tears, holes, and localized wear, as well as seam repairs and patching for damaged sections.

Are there options for repairing carpet in high-traffic areas? Yes, local service providers can perform targeted repairs to reinforce or replace heavily worn or damaged sections in high-traffic zones.

How do local contractors handle carpet seam repairs? They typically re-stretch or re-sew seams to ensure a smooth, even surface and prevent further separation or damage.
